Lectures On Irregularities Of Distribution
by Wolfgang M. Schmidt
Publisher: Tata Institute of Fundamental Research 1977
Number of pages: 137
Description:
The theory of Irregularities of Distribution began as a branch of Uniform Distributions, but is of independent interest. In these lectures the author restricted himself to distribution problems with a geometric interpretation.
